The Christian Heritage Party of Canada claims to be "Canada's only pro-Life, pro-family federal political party, and the only federal party that endorses the principles of the Preamble to the Charter of Rights and Freedoms in the Canadian Constitution: 'Canada was founded upon principles that recognize the supremacy of God and the rule of law.'" This effectively means that it opposes abortion and especially illegal abortions.